Description

Neocoelidiinae are easily recognisable by their very long antennae and distinctive head shape. Many species are incredibly vibrant and are most diverse in the
neotropics The Neotropical realm is one of the eight biogeographic realms constituting Earth's land surface. Physically, it includes the tropical terrestrial ecoregions of the Americas and the entire South American temperate zone. Definition In bi ...
. There are some species found in the neararctic region, specifically in the genus ''Neocoelidia''.

Krocodonini

A South American
tribe The term tribe is used in many different contexts to refer to a category of human social group. The predominant worldwide usage of the term in English is in the discipline of anthropology. This definition is contested, in part due to confl ...
, created by Marques-Costa & Cavichioli in 2012. * '' Krocarites'' Dietrich & Vega, 1995 * '' Krocodona'' Kramer, 1964 * '' Krocolidia'' Dietrich, 2003 * '' Krocozzota'' Kramer, 1964 * '' Retrolidia'' Dietrich, 2003
